We plan to begin the Sprague School Kindness Olympics at tomorrow’s school gathering. Each class will receive a ‘kindness jar’ and students will be able to add marbles to the jar when they report an act of kindness. Each class will have a Kindness Olympics poster with the 5 Olympic rings on it. Students can think about the rings as reminders of ways they can be kind:

Blue—Do something kind for a friend or classmate

Black—Do something to help someone who is older OR younger than you

Red–Do something to make our school better

Yellow—Do something friendly or inclusive

Green—Do something for someone in your family

The class that tallies the most acts of kindness will get some special privileges as a prize. We’ll let them know in 2 weeks. The Kindness Olympic Challenge will run from Feb. 2 to Feb. 16. At the school gathering tomorrow, we will share the story of the 2 Olympic runners who helped one another during the 2016 Rio Games.

 

The A-Catemy Awards are listed below in Dates to Remember. This is a celebration of reading and students’ favorite books in conjunction with Dr. Seuss’s birthday and Read Across America Day. Each year, students vote on favorites in specific categories like Favorite Picture Book or Funniest Book or Favorite MCBA Book during Library time. We then reveal the winners at the A-Catemy Awards ceremony. We use the Academy Awards theme idea and have a red carpet first. Students are invited to dress up and ‘glam’ up for this day. Teachers take this very seriously…perhaps too seriously as many old prom dresses seem to be resurrected for the event. In any case, it is very fun and a great way to celebrate reading. We always welcome ‘Paparazzi’ and “Momarazzi” to come see us and take photos on the red carpet. The date will be March 2 at 8:45 AM.
